NEWBURGH, NY - On May 16th, Good-Will and Middlehope FDs held a joint drill on Pepsi Way to go over setting up landing zones for incoming Medevac helicopters. After the LZ was set up a Life Net helicopter circled the area from the east and then landed in a field. The crew got out of the helicopter, introduced themselves to the firefighters and started explaining what they look for when approaching a LZ. They spot trees and wires, and also see if the field is level or inclined. At night they look for wires and use night goggles to spot things they can't see. Firefighters then asked questions and the crew gave them a tour of the inside of the helicopter. After 90 minutes the crew got back into the helicopter and lifted off. It was a well informed drill and many firefighters came back with new information that they can use for next time.
